Daimler Truck Holding AG (DTG) - Total Liabilities

Latest as of March 2026: €52.20 Billion EUR ≈ $61.03 Billion USD

Based on the latest financial reports, Daimler Truck Holding AG (DTG) has total liabilities worth €52.20 Billion EUR (≈ $61.03 Billion USD) as of March 2026.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Annual Total Liabilities for Daimler Truck Holding AG (2018–2025)

The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Daimler Truck Holding AG from 2018 to 2025.

Year Total Liabilities Change
2025-12-31 €50.46 Billion
≈ $58.99 Billion
-1.06%
2024-12-31 €51.00 Billion
≈ $59.63 Billion
+4.12%
2023-12-31 €48.99 Billion
≈ $57.27 Billion
+12.97%
2022-12-31 €43.36 Billion
≈ $50.70 Billion
+12.99%
2021-12-31 €38.38 Billion
≈ $44.87 Billion
-7.03%
2020-12-31 €41.28 Billion
≈ $48.26 Billion
-8.31%
2019-12-31 €45.02 Billion
≈ $52.64 Billion
+10.78%
2018-12-31 €40.64 Billion
≈ $47.51 Billion
--

About

Daimler Truck Holding AG manufactures and sells light, medium- and heavy-duty trucks and buses in Europe, North America, Asia, Latin America, and internationally. The company operates through five segments: Trucks North America, Mercedes-Benz Trucks, Trucks Asia, Daimler Buses, and Financial Services.
